About Stevenage Borough Council

Stevenage is a large town within Hertfordshire, with great connections to London (fast trains will take you to the capital in under 20 minutes), Cambridge and neighbouring towns including Hitchin and Welwyn Garden City.  The town benefits from distinct shopping areas including The Town Centre, Roaring Meg Retail Park and Stevenage Old Town. Each area offers different experiences, with national brands ranging from Marks & Spencer to independent shops that are unique to Stevenage.

Aside from its shopping offer, the town has a dedicated Leisure Park with a cinema and bowling offer in addition to other adult and child-friendly indoor activities and restaurants.

Stevenage town centre is the UK's first wholly pedestrianised shopping centre, where brands such as Pandora, Next and Primark coexist alongside a mix of independent shops, restaurants, coffee shops and the Stevenage Museum.  The town centre houses the Westgate Shopping Centre which is home to over 30 popular high street names in a covered setting.  This is in addition to the popular Indoor Market.
